What is a Personal Injury Attorney?
A personal injury attorney specializes in supplying legal representation to people who have sustained physical or mental injuries due to the negligence or misbehavior of another party. These lawyers are well-versed in tort law, which incorporates all civil claims for injuries and damages.

Leverage their know-how can considerably impact the result of your case, helping you protect the compensation you should have for medical costs, lost earnings, and discomfort and suffering.

Understanding the steps associated with a personal injury claim can help clients feel more ready. Here's a basic summary of the process:

Initial Consultation: The customer meets with the attorney to talk about the case, examine its merits, and identify the best strategy.

Examination: The attorney will carry out an extensive investigation, collecting evidence, interviewing witnesses, and consulting specialists if necessary.

Submitting a Claim: The attorney will sue with the appropriate insurer, detailing the injury and asking for compensation.

Settlement: If the preliminary offer is inadequate, the attorney will negotiate with the insurance adjuster to secure a reasonable settlement.

Litigation: If negotiations fail, the case might go to trial. The attorney will prepare the case for court, presenting proof and arguing on behalf of the customer.

Settlement or Verdict: The case concludes either through a negotiated settlement or a court ruling.

When should I hire an accident attorney?
It is advisable to seek advice from an injury attorney as soon as possible after an [Accident Injury Attorney](https://mendoza-allred.thoughtlanes.net/10-undeniable-reasons-people-hate-neck-injury-lawyer). Early legal advice can improve the outcome of your claim.
2. Just how much does it cost to hire an injury attorney?
Many injury attorneys work on a contingency cost basis, indicating you owe them nothing unless they win your case.
3. How long do I need to submit an injury claim?
The statute of restrictions differs by state however generally ranges from one to 6 years. It's vital to examine the particular laws in your jurisdiction.
4. What if my injury is partly my fault?
In many states, you can still recuperate damages if you share some fault for the accident. Nevertheless, the compensation may be reduced by your portion of liability.
5. What kinds of damages can I claim?
Damages can include medical expenditures, lost salaries, discomfort and suffering, and often compensatory damages for gross carelessness.
